Re: USB to Serial drivers for Mac OS X



Melvin,

We are currently using adapters from Serial IO. They are a little bit cheaper than the Keyspan adapters at about $18 a piece.

     https://serialio.com//store/product_info.php?products_id=30

They also sell a Java library that you can use, but I haven't had any problems using RXTX. I believe that their library also uses the Java Comm API, if you had written code around RXTX and decided you needed their library for some reason, you wouldn't have to rewrite much code.
